Background to the Brontës (AS/A2)

An informal, lively talk which looks at the historical and social context of the Brontës' novels as well as the lives of the Brontës themselves. How did their early lives shape their later work, and who were the writers who influenced them? How far did wider world events such as colonialism impact on their work, and what were the particular problems for a woman wanting to get published? The talk uses Powerpoint images, and there is plenty of opportunity for questions and discussion.

(This talk focuses particularly on either Emily Brontë or Charlotte Brontë, depending on text studied.)
